What Are Navy Blue and Green Area Rugs?
Navy blue and green area rugs are decorative floor coverings that come in various shades of blue and green. These rugs can be made from a variety of materials such as wool, cotton, or synthetic fibers. They are commonly found in rectangular shapes and come in a range of sizes to fit any room.
Why Are Navy Blue and Green Area Rugs So Popular?
Navy blue and green area rugs have become increasingly popular in recent years due to their versatility and ability to complement a variety of decor styles. These rugs can add a pop of color to neutral spaces or can be used to tie together a room with other blue and green accents. Additionally, navy blue and green are calming colors that can create a relaxing and peaceful atmosphere in any room.
Step-by-Step Guide for Current Trends on Navy Blue and Green Area Rugs
- Choose the right size for your room. Measure the space where you want to place the rug and choose a size that fits the space.
- Select the right shade of blue and green. Consider the other colors in your room and choose a shade that complements them.
- Choose a material that fits your lifestyle. If you have pets or children, consider a rug that is easy to clean and can withstand wear and tear.
- Decide on a pattern. Navy blue and green area rugs come in a variety of patterns, such as stripes or geometric shapes. Choose one that fits your personal style.
- Accessorize with complementary colors. Navy blue and green area rugs can be paired with other blue and green accents or can be complemented with pops of other colors.

Question and Answer / FAQs
Q: Are navy blue and green area rugs suitable for high traffic areas?
A: It depends on the material and quality of the rug. If you have a high traffic area, consider choosing a navy blue and green area rug made from a durable material such as wool or a synthetic fiber.
Q: How do I clean a navy blue and green area rug?
A: It is important to follow the manufacturer’s cleaning instructions for your specific rug. Generally, vacuuming regularly and spot cleaning with a mild detergent and warm water can help maintain the rug’s color and pattern.
